Developer Relations Intern
About the Role
You will engage directly with developers across forums, social channels, and events to provide support and build relationships. You will create tutorials, blog posts, sample code, and videos to help developers adopt products. You will troubleshoot technical issues, gather developer feedback, help improve documentation, and assist in organizing hackathons, workshops, and webinars. You will also represent the product in online communities and at events.
Requirements
- Pursuing or recently completed a degree in Computer Science or related field
- Strong passion for technology and software development
- Excellent communication and interpersonal skills
- Proficiency in at least one programming language such as Python, JavaScript, or Java
- Familiarity with software development tools and platforms such as GitHub or GitLab
- Ability to work independently, prioritize tasks, and meet deadlines
- Previous experience in developer relations, technical writing, or community management is a plus
Responsibilities
- Engage with developers through online forums, social media, and events
- Create technical content such as blog posts, tutorials, videos, and sample code
- Provide technical support and troubleshoot developer issues
- Collect and communicate developer feedback to product and engineering teams
- Organize and support hackathons, workshops, webinars, and conferences
- Improve product documentation based on developer feedback
- Advocate for products by participating in developer communities and speaking at events
Benefits
- Hands-on experience in developer relations and community engagement
- Exposure to cutting-edge technologies and developer tools
- Opportunity to work closely with experienced professionals
- Flexible work environment and supportive team culture
